Output 65424ae96155aa8dbeae4b37552d29e518f4c73aecdd1e4c35a2a25865c0e404:0

value
21552954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f41a28c05113fad232b8bf67ce352125fcc28398 OP_EQUALVERIFY OP_CHECKSIG
address
1PFhDNxhgEv63ECuou28j3cD4eRuxU8XPB
transaction
65424ae96155aa8dbeae4b37552d29e518f4c73aecdd1e4c35a2a25865c0e404
spent
true